Using Machine Learning to Identify Change in Surgical Decision Making in Current Use of Damage Control Laparotomy.

Abstract

BACKGROUND: In an earlier study, we reported the successful reduction in the use of damage control laparotomy (DCL); however, no change in the relative frequencies of specific indications was observed. In this study, we aimed to use machine learning to help identify the changes in surgical decision making that occurred.
